Abstract:

To provide a simple, highly energy efficient, industrially advantageous method and system for obtaining high-purity propane from low-purity propane.

At least one of water, carbon dioxide, ethane, and propylene and at least one of isobutane and normal butane in gas-phase low-purity propane are adsorbed with: a molecular sieve zeolite that adsorbs water and carbon dioxide with higher priority than propane; molecular sieve activated carbon that adsorbs ethane and propylene with higher priority than propane; and activated carbon that adsorbs isobutane and normal butane with higher priority than propane. By introducing the gas-phase low-purity propane into a dephlegmator, propane is condensed in a state where nitrogen and oxygen are kept in the gas phase. Nitrogen and oxygen in the gas phase are removed from the dephlegmator.
